Output 8e99f66e534037de71b9bc4f7c11a23f6800cd07e6d09bc742163785c8cf62f5:0

value
11523328
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 19711497caa95d139ec23476a140676930499af4 OP_EQUALVERIFY OP_CHECKSIG
address
13KXMmEERchFH6DPW6MSf52P4nXevJcSFu
transaction
8e99f66e534037de71b9bc4f7c11a23f6800cd07e6d09bc742163785c8cf62f5
spent
true